Limit States Design (LSD) is a design approach that aims to ensure that a structure can withstand various loads and stresses without failing or deteriorating over its intended lifespan. This approach considers the limit states of a structure, which are the conditions beyond which the structure becomes unfit for its intended use. The LSD method provides a more accurate and reliable way of designing structures compared to traditional methods, as it takes into account the uncertainties and variability of loads, materials, and construction processes.
